Russia ‘pauses’ Ukraine’s incursion; Kyiv says 74 areas in its control, but occupation not the goal

Russian forces repelled a Ukrainian attempt to further incursion in the Kursk region, halting armoured groups near several settlements. Kyiv stated the operation aimed to protect Ukraine from long-range attacks originating from Kursk. Ukraine’s military commander reported control over 74 settlements and 40sqkm gained in the past day.
